Types of Home Security Cameras for Doorways

There are two main types of home security cameras suitable for doorways:
Wired Cameras: These cameras require physical wiring to an electrical outlet and provide a more reliable connection. Wired cameras generally offer higher image quality and are less susceptible to interference.
Wireless Cameras: Wireless cameras are battery-powered or solar-powered and connect to Wi-Fi. They offer greater flexibility in placement, but may have lower image quality and reliability issues.

Features to Consider When Choosing a Doorway Camera

When selecting a doorway camera, consider the following features:
Field of View: The field of view determines how wide an area the camera can capture. A wider field of view is better for covering large areas, while a narrower field of view is better for zooming in on specific areas.
Resolution: Resolution refers to the number of pixels in the camera's image. A higher resolution produces clearer images with more detail.
Night Vision: Night vision allows the camera to capture images in low-light conditions. Infrared night vision is common, but some cameras also offer color night vision.
Two-Way Audio: This feature allows you to communicate with people through the camera's built-in microphone and speaker.
Motion Detection: Motion detection triggers the camera to record or send alerts when it detects movement.
Cloud Storage: Cloud storage allows you to remotely access and store video footage.
Integration with Smart Home Systems: Some cameras can integrate with smart home systems like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ant, allowing you to control them with voice commands.

Installation and Maintenance

Once you have chosen a camera, follow the manufacturer's instructions for installation. Most cameras come with mounting hardware and easy-to-follow guides. Make sure to place the camera in a location that provides the best coverage of your doorway.

Regularly check the camera's power source, clean the lens, and update the firmware to ensure optimal performance.
